What happens during the evaporative phase of refrigeration?

During the evaporative phase of refrigeration, the refrigerant absorbs heat from the surrounding environment and changes from a liquid to a gas. This phase occurs in the evaporator coil, where the low-pressure liquid refrigerant enters and absorbs heat from the area that needs to be cooled. As it absorbs this heat, the refrigerant undergoes a phase change, evaporating into a gas. This process is essential for lowering temperatures in refrigeration systems, as the absorption of heat from the environment creates a cooling effect.

In addition to the main process, there are important thermodynamic principles at play. The efficiency of refrigeration systems relies on the ability to absorb a significant amount of heat while evaporating, which is why this phase is crucial in the overall refrigeration cycle. Understanding this phase helps in the proper maintenance and troubleshooting of refrigeration systems, ensuring they operate effectively and efficiently.
